Original Abstract

This paper deals with the issue of detection of internal defects and failures of concrete structures with emphasis on the use of non-destructive methods. All parts of the structure that reduce its service life or bearing capacity can be considered as internal defects and failures. These are, for example, gravel nests, cracks, delamination, caverns etc. Due to the prevalence of concrete structures, the development of this part of diagnostics is very important both for the safety of their users and to reduce the economic costs of their future repairs.
